Output 21a32bae30a4530cd65587ebeecd9d7667dad3a93f1e12175883e1ed3c22c388:0

value
34423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 622ee66174b36240614a8621163edb112178a5cb OP_EQUAL
address
3AeAL1MsdXe61w2AzUghGdx9WjPxqiBP9J
transaction
21a32bae30a4530cd65587ebeecd9d7667dad3a93f1e12175883e1ed3c22c388